Campaign to save historic inn gathers pace

Residents of Sibson, near Hinckley, Leicestershire are taking action to save their 750-year-old village pub, the Cock Inn. The Grade II-listed pub closed in November 2019, much to the disappointment of villagers. At the time, owner Star Pubs and Bars applied for planning permission for repair works to the windows, roof and other areas, to “stablise the building”.
